Understanding Zero-Knowledge Proofs and Their Role in Blockchain Security

Understanding Zero-Knowledge Proofs and Their Role in Blockchain Security

Hey everyone! Today, I want to dive into a fascinating topic that has been making waves in the blockchain world: zero-knowledge proofs (ZKPs). If you’ve been following the crypto scene, you might have come across this term, but what exactly does it mean, and why is it so important for blockchain security? Let’s unpack it!

First off, let’s start with the basics. In simple terms, a zero-knowledge proof is a cryptographic method that allows one party to prove to another that they know a value (like a password or a private key) without revealing the actual value itself. Imagine you’re trying to convince a friend that you can unlock a secret door without actually showing them the key. That’s the essence of zero-knowledge proofs!

What makes ZKPs particularly exciting in the context of blockchain is their potential to enhance privacy and security. As we know, blockchain technology is inherently transparent—every transaction is recorded on a public ledger for all to see. While this transparency is one of the technology’s strengths, it can also be a double-edged sword when it comes to privacy. This is where zero-knowledge proofs shine.

By incorporating ZKPs into blockchain protocols, we can validate transactions without disclosing sensitive information. For instance, imagine a scenario where you want to prove you have enough funds to make a transaction without revealing your entire balance. ZKPs allow you to do just that! This could be a game changer for industries where confidentiality is paramount, such as finance or healthcare.

One of the most prominent applications of zero-knowledge proofs in the crypto space is with privacy coins like Zcash. Zcash utilizes ZKPs to provide users with the option to make shielded transactions, ensuring that only the sender and recipient can see the transaction details, while the network remains oblivious. It’s a brilliant way to maintain privacy without sacrificing security.

As I delve deeper into this subject, I can’t help but feel excited about the implications of zero-knowledge proofs for the future of blockchain. They offer a pathway to creating more secure and private decentralized applications, enabling users to interact without exposing their personal data. In a world where data breaches and privacy concerns are rampant, ZKPs could become a cornerstone of blockchain technology.

Of course, like any technology, ZKPs are not without their challenges. Implementing them can be computationally intensive, which raises questions about scalability. However, ongoing research and development are working towards addressing these issues, and I’m optimistic about what’s to come.

In conclusion, zero-knowledge proofs represent an innovative solution for enhancing privacy and security in blockchain applications. As the crypto space continues to evolve, I believe ZKPs will play a crucial role in shaping a more secure future for our digital interactions. I’m eager to see how this technology unfolds in the coming years!

If you’re as fascinated by zero-knowledge proofs as I am, let’s discuss! What are your thoughts on their potential impact on blockchain security? Drop a comment below, and let’s chat!